    Stříkací pistole pro práškové lakování s tryskou 1,3 mm

    Spray guns with a 1.3 mm nozzle are among the most popular all-round options for painting. This nozzle diameter is ideal for applying primers, fillers and thicker lacquers, and allows fast coverage of medium-sized areas.

    Uses for the 1.3 mm nozzle: The 1.3 mm diameter falls into the middle nozzle category, able to handle ordinary paints and lacquers across the board. Narrower nozzles (1.0 mm, for example) are used for very thin materials and fine detail, while wider ones (1.7 mm and up) are meant for extra-thick coatings. The 1.3 mm nozzle is the ideal compromise – it copes with primers, fillers and thicker lacquers without the gun clogging or "spitting" paint. Compared with the smaller 1.2 mm it also applies a greater volume of material, which speeds up work on medium-sized parts while keeping a quality spray pattern.

    Examples of use: This nozzle diameter proves itself especially where a decent volume of applied paint has to combine with a still sufficiently fine mist. Typical applications include:

    • Applying body primers and fillers (during repairs and priming of body parts before the top coat, for example).
    • Painting machine and process parts – equipment components with intricate or larger surfaces.
    • Spraying surfaces with a coarser texture that need a heavier coat to even them out (thicker paint fills irregularities better).
    • Workshop painting of larger items (big metal structures, frames, cabinets and the like), where the 1.3 mm nozzle allows fast area coverage without needlessly long spraying.

    Recommended pressure: For spray guns with a 1.3 mm nozzle a working pressure of around 2 bar is usually chosen. Modern HVLP guns reach optimum atomisation at an inlet pressure of about 1.8–2.2 bar (depending on the model), while more economical LVLP models can work at slightly lower pressure. Too low a pressure gives a coarse spray and imperfect atomisation; too high a pressure causes excessive misting and higher material consumption. It is therefore best to follow the gun maker's recommendation (typically the 2 bar mentioned) so the 1.3 mm nozzle delivers its best – a fine, even coat with no runs.

    Advantages over 1.2 mm: Compared with the smaller 1.2 mm nozzle, the 1.3 mm offers higher paint flow and therefore faster coverage of larger areas. It applies thicker materials more safely, where a 1.2 mm nozzle could easily clog. Overall the 1.3 mm is more versatile – one gun with this nozzle handles more types of work (from primers to painting larger parts). The 1.2 mm nozzle, by contrast, suits smaller areas or very thin, runny paints where you value an extra-fine mist, but you must accept slower application.

    The 1.4 mm alternative: One step up, the 1.4 mm nozzle applies even more material in less time, which helps on genuinely large areas or extra-heavy coatings (high-solids 2K primers, high-build topcoats). For ordinary painting, though, 1.4 mm may be unnecessarily large – it requires careful setting so that thin lacquers do not run or overspray. That is why many painters choose 1.3 mm as the golden middle way that covers most needs. If you plan mainly fine work or very thin materials, the smaller 1.2 mm nozzle may suit you better. For the fastest work on large areas and dense coatings, consider the larger 1.4 mm nozzle.
